Charles Johns
Ashford/Purley
Charles Johns Charles Johns was born in the naval dockyard town of Devonport in 1887. He began his professional career at the Southdown club in Shoreham in 1908 and moved to Ashford Manor a couple of years later. He took up the post of professional at Purley Downs around the start of the First World War and, after active service in the war, returned here, serving the club until 1947.

He was a good clubmaker and seemed to have a penchant for specialty wooden clubs: wooden cleeks, bulldog spoons, 'trouble woods', baffies and the like.
